Biography
Dr. Maciej Fronczak received his scientific experience and education at the Faculty of Chemistry, University of Warsaw (Poland). He obtained his B.Sc. in 2012, M.Sc. in 2014, and Ph. D. in 2019. His research was focused on novel functional materials, applied in adsorption and catalysis. Since 2019 he has been an assistant professor at the Department of Molecular Engineering, Faculty of Process and Environmental Engineering, Lodz University of Technology (Poland). His experience involves two short-term postdoctoral internships at the Institute of Materials and Environmental Chemistry, Research Centre for Natural Sciences (Budapest, Hungary) in 2021 and the Institute of Chemistry, Technology and Metallurgy, University of Belgrade, in 2022 (Serbia). Currently, his activities cover the application of low-pressure, non-equilibrium, cold plasma in surface engineering and catalysis.
